With the slogan "Your NO Counts", the 2009 International Anti-Corruption Day presents an opportunity to raise awareness about corruption and its devastating effects on societies worldwide. The 2009 International Day will highlight key tools to fight corruption, such as the United Nations Convention against Corruption. This year the United Nations Office on Drugs and Crime (UNODC) and the United Nations Development Programme (UNDP) have developed a joint global campaign, focusing on how corruption impacts education, health, justice, democracy, prosperity and development. Corruption is a crime that can undermine social and economic development in all societies. No country, region or community is immune.
